What are magnesium supplements used for in alternative medicine?

Magnesium is considered an important nutrient in alternative medicine and is associated with a wide range of health benefits. Some common uses for magnesium supplements include:

1. Nervous System Support: Magnesium is known for its role in supporting the normal functioning of the nervous system. Alternative medicine practitioners may recommend it to promote relaxation, reduce anxiety, and improve sleep.

2. Muscle Function and Recovery: Magnesium plays a crucial role in muscle function. As such, it is often recommended to support muscle health, prevent cramps, and enhance athletic performance and recovery.

3. Cardiovascular Health: Some alternative practitioners believe that magnesium can support heart health by assisting with blood pressure regulation and reducing the risk of cardiovascular diseases.

4. Bone Health: Magnesium is important for bone health and mineralization. It may be recommended to maintain healthy bones and reduce the risk of conditions like osteoporosis.

5. Electrolyte Balance: Magnesium contributes to electrolyte balance in the body. Alternative practitioners may recommend it for hydration and electrolyte replenishment, especially during intense physical activities or in hot climates.

6. Migraine Prevention: Some individuals report using magnesium supplements to help reduce the frequency and severity of migraines.

7. Stress Management: Magnesium is believed to have calming effects, which may help manage stress and anxiety in alternative medicine practices.

It's important to note that while magnesium supplements may offer some benefits, it's always advisable to consult a healthcare professional before adding any supplements to your regimen, as they may interact with certain medications or have specific contraindications.
